НАГРУЗОЧНОЕ ТЕСТИРОВАНИЕ PHP

Нагрузочное тестирование PHP – это процесс проверки производительности веб-приложений, написанных на PHP, под нарастающей нагрузкой. Если ваше приложение подвергается высокой нагрузке, то это может привести к снижению производительности, падению сайта или даже к работе нарушению в приложении. Таким образом, выполнение нагрузочного тестирования на ранней стадии работы приложения помогает выявить проблемы производительности и обеспечить лучшую работоспособность.

Для выполнения нагрузочного тестирования, вы можете использовать различные инструменты. В PHP существует несколько популярных библиотек для тестирования производительности, такие как PHPUnit и Apache JMeter.

Вот простой пример кода PHPUnit для тестирования производительности:

$this->benchmark(function() { // Здесь находится ваш код для тестирования производительности });

Если вам нужно более продвинутое тестирование производительности, вы можете использовать Apache JMeter. Он может симулировать тысячи пользователей, которые обращаются к вашему приложению одновременно, чтобы проверить, как приложение работает в реальной среде высокой нагрузки.

Важно заметить, что нагрузочное тестирование должно проводиться на продакшене, а не на тестовом окружении. Это обеспечивает лучшую точность и помогает обнаруживать проблемы производительности, которых вы можете не заметить в среде тестирования.

Урок 1. Модульное тестирование на PHP. PHPUnit. Установка PHPUnit

JMeter ОБЗОР / УСТАНОВКА / И ВАШ ПЕРВЫЙ НАГРУЗОЧНЫЙ ТЕСТ

Обзор JMeter - Что такое JMeter? - Нагрузочное тестирование в JMeter.

#18 Уроки PHP - Учим язык PHP, Поразрядные операторы на языке PHP

Нагрузочное тестирование (лайвкодинг)

php unit testing tutorial for beginners [ Test Driven Development ] Full guide

Собеседование. Вопрос-Ответ. Примеры нагрузочного тестирования

Счётчик онлайна на PHP! ► Сколько пользователей на сайте?

PHP. Учить или не учить? Вот в чём вопрос!

Реклама
Новое
Реклама